The internodium.org portal reported last week that US NGOs CHF Montenegro (Community, Habitat and Finance), International Relief and Development (IRD) and the Academy for Educational Development announced the implementation of “Montenegro Connect” project for establishment of wireless network on the whole territory of Montenegro.

ITU TELECOM WORLD 2006, the leading global ICT event, will be held in Hong Kong, China from 4-8 December. This is the first time this key networking event is being held away from its traditional home in Geneva.

Ghana and the World Bank have signed two separate agreements for a grant of $55 million towards the implementation of the e-Ghana Project and the education for all-fast track initiative.

The World Bank Group has approved a $40 million loan to Ghana, to support the implementation of selected components of the government?s Information and Communications Technology, (ICT) for Accelerated Development Policy.

The Commonwealth Secretariat is assisting the Government of Bangladesh's 20 million taka (£153,000) initiative to develop four rural information and communication technology (ICT) access centres in the South Asian nation to promote the use of ICT for community development and commerce.

Nigeria's National Information Technology Development Agency and the Korea Agency for Digital Opportunity and Promotion at the weekend signed a Memorandum of Understanding to increase information communication technology penetration in Nigeria.
